Islamabad: Imran Khan has been sworn in as Pakistan’s 22nd Prime Minister on Saturday.

President Mamnoon Hussain administered him oath at the Aiwan-e-Sadr (the President House) in Islamabad.

The ceremony commenced with the national anthem, followed by recitation of verses from the Holy Quran.

Navjot Singh Sidhu, Rameez Raja,Wasim Akram were among the guests present at oath taking ceremony.
